Abstract
General objectives of the water quality control study are to assess the probable effects of the proposed project on water quality in local streams and reservoirs; to ascertain the benefits or harm resulting from changes in water quality; to assess the suitability of the water for proposed water uses; and to determine the need for and the value of storage for regulation of streamflow for the purpose of water quality control. The study covers Duchesne County in northeastern Utah. The need for streamflow regulation was studied not only for the present conditions, but also for anticipated future conditions in the year 2060.
